Energy drinks are beverages that typically contain caffeine, sugar, and other ingredients like vitamins and amino acids. The primary purpose of energy drinks is to increase alertness and provide a quick boost of energy. Whether an energy drink can bring a good mood depends on the individual and the circumstances.

Caffeine, the main active ingredient in most energy drinks, is a stimulant that can temporarily improve mood and reduce feelings of fatigue. It may also enhance cognitive function, attention, and focus. For some people, consuming an energy drink can indeed result in a temporary improvement in mood and a feeling of increased energy.

However, it's important to note that the effects of energy drinks can vary from person to person, and excessive consumption can lead to adverse effects. Some potential downsides of energy drinks include:

  1. Crashes: After the initial energy boost wears off, individuals may experience a crash in energy levels, leading to feelings of fatigue and irritability.

  2. Insomnia and sleep disturbances: The high caffeine content in energy drinks can disrupt sleep patterns, leading to difficulty falling asleep or staying asleep.

  3. Anxiety and jitters: Some individuals may be more sensitive to caffeine, which can lead to increased anxiety, nervousness, and shakiness.

  4. Increased heart rate and blood pressure: High caffeine intake can cause a temporary increase in heart rate and blood pressure, which may not be suitable for individuals with certain health conditions.

  5. Dependency: Regular consumption of energy drinks can lead to caffeine dependency, making it difficult to function without them.

In the long run, the consumption of energy drinks is generally not considered a sustainable strategy for maintaining good mood and overall well-being. Instead, a balanced and healthy lifestyle that includes proper nutrition, regular exercise, adequate sleep, and stress management is recommended for promoting a positive mood and sustained energy levels.

If you find yourself relying on energy drinks to boost your mood frequently, it may be a good idea to assess your overall lifestyle and consider healthier alternatives for maintaining energy and well-being. If you have concerns about your mood or energy levels, it's always best to consult a healthcare professional for personalized advice and guidance.
